ODB, Gail Kim, and Roxxi vs. The Beautiful People and Mickey Muscle

For half a year, Velvet Sky and Angelina Love have been doing their hardest to make the lives of other TNA Knockouts a living hell.

They took a step too far at Sacrifice when they caused Roxxi to have her head shaved after a ladder match, then added more gas to the fire by costing Gail Kim the TNA Knockouts Championship days later.

Now we get to this Sunday, and payback is on the minds of three of these Knockouts.

The BP have enlisted the services of a strong woman named Mickey to handle the heavy work while they sit on the apron and try their hardest not to look like a couple of groupies from Guns and Roses.

In any event, expect the hair and claws to be flying when these six vixens let it all hang out.

TNA X Division Championship

"Maple Leaf Muscle" Petey Williams vs. Kaz

Ever since winning the X Division Championship in controversial fashion, Petey Williams has forced the rest of us to revel in it. But like his Obi Wan, Scott Steiner, this young cocky Skywalker could come up short against a determined Jedi.

Kaz has been on a roll for the last few months, and there's a possibility that the road that started with a good showing against Kurt Angle could end with a double shot of gold.

After winning the inaugural Terrordome match at Sacrifice, Kaz earned the right to face "Little Petey Pump" at Slammiversary.

In some matches, there always has to be a good guy and a bad guy. But in this match, it's a man who was been handed the contract and the gold on a battered platter taking on a man who had to claw his way to the top.

Barring any outside interference, take a wild guess who will win this contest.

TNA World Tag Team Championship

Team 3D vs. The Latin American Xchange

It's a rivalry reborn this Sunday when professional wrestling's most decorated tag team takes on one of the biggest up-and-comers in the sport.

After beating Team 3D at Sacrifice in the Deuces Wild Tag Team Finals, LAX has been on a roll.  

With their Latina vixen Salinas and motivator Hector Guerrero by their side, they haven't been stopped. But the team from New York are acting like the Yankeesthey won't go away quietly.

Despite being left bloodied a few weeks ago, LAX has the advantage as the defending champions.

Brother Ray and Brother Devon better bring their A-Game because LAX has quickly learned the motto of the Guerrero Familylie, cheat, and steal.

Kurt Angle vs. AJ Styles

It won't be a first blood match. It won't be a last man standing match. But it will be a bloodbathand there will be only one man standing after this match is done.

Ever since AJ "married" Karen Angle, the saga between the three individuals has gone from bizarre, to insane, to downright lethal.

The male Angle has been hell-bent on destroying Styles ever since he has decided to continue his relationship with Mrs. Angle.

After Kurt sent his wife away in tears and disgusted for his decisions, he wanted to fix the issue, but did a terrible job at apologizing.

After a physical match against Booker T, AJ Styles was assaulted by several TNA superstars before Kurt Angle came in and played home run derby on the already bloodied wrestler.

After months of dispair and insanity, it all comes to head this Sunday when the Olympic Champion and The Prince of Phenomenal collide with the ultimate prize of Karen Angle's heart hanging in the balance.

King of the Mountain Match for the TNA World Championship

Samoa Joe vs. Robert Roode vs. Booker T vs. Christian Cage vs. Rhyno

Since the beginning of Slammiversary, the King of the Mountain match has made superstars into legends. This Sunday, one man moves one step closer to immortality.

Since winning the TNA World Heavyweight Championship from Kurt Angle, Samoa Joe has been determined to prove that he is a fighting champion. After outlasting both Angle and Scott Steiner at Sacrifice, he now has to outlast four men who want what he's got.

Two former World Champions (Cage and Rhyno), and two men who haven't gotten a shot at immortality before (Roode and Booker), will try to take out the Samoan Submission Machine and hope to begin their reign as the TNA World Champion.

Quick history fact: No TNA World Champion has ever entered the match and left the match as champion.

Samoa Joe intends to break that cycle on Sunday night. But to do that, he will have to withstand the onslaught of four dangerous individuals, a lot of ladders, and the special enforcer for the matchKevin Nash.

This Sunday, live from the DeSoto Civic Center in Southhaven, MS, it's the sixth annual Slammiversary on pay per view.
